{"id":13905602,"url":"https://github.com/k3b/APhotoManager","last_synced_at":"2025-07-18T03:30:50.693Z","repository":{"id":35523344,"uuid":"39793957","full_name":"k3b/APhotoManager","owner":"k3b","description":"Manage local photos on Android: gallery, geotag with photomap, privacy, tags, find, sort, view, copy, send, ... .","archived":false,"fork":false,"pushed_at":"2022-09-05T10:49:55.000Z","size":9066,"stargazers_count":223,"open_issues_count":46,"forks_count":57,"subscribers_count":16,"default_branch":"FDroid","last_synced_at":"2024-05-21T13:02:44.154Z","etag":null,"topics":["android","backup","exif","gallery","geo-uri","geolocation","geotag","gpx","jpg","kml","locationpicker","map","map-viewer","openstreetmap","osm","photo-gallery","photo-manager","photos","privacy","xmp"],"latest_commit_sha":null,"homepage":"","language":"Java","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"gpl-3.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/k3b.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2015-07-27T19:37:06.000Z","updated_at":"2024-05-10T13:47:42.000Z","dependencies_parsed_at":"2023-01-15T22:45:24.607Z","dependency_job_id":null,"html_url":"https://github.com/k3b/APhotoManager","commit_stats":null,"previous_names":[],"tags_count":45,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/k3b%2FAPhotoManager","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/k3b%2FAPhotoManager/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/k3b%2FAPhotoManager/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/k3b%2FAPhotoManager/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/k3b","download_url":"https://codeload.github.com/k3b/APhotoManager/tar.gz/refs/heads/FDroid","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":226150261,"owners_count":17581274,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["android","backup","exif","gallery","geo-uri","geolocation","geotag","gpx","jpg","kml","locationpicker","map","map-viewer","openstreetmap","osm","photo-gallery","photo-manager","photos","privacy","xmp"],"created_at":"2024-08-06T23:01:19.610Z","updated_at":"2024-11-25T13:31:32.232Z","avatar_url":"https://github.com/k3b.png","language":"Java","funding_links":[],"categories":["Java"],"sub_categories":[],"readme":"Starting with android-10 google has removed the capability to get geo data from the media database so the main purpose of this app: show/find photos through a geographic map is gone forever.\n\nI spend several months of work to implement a shadow copy of the media database but in the end a gave up.\n\nAPhotoManger is dead :-(\n\nRIP\n\n--------\n\n\n# ![](https://raw.githubusercontent.com/k3b/APhotoManager/master/app/src/main/res/drawable-hdpi/foto_gallery.png) \"A Photo Manager\" with \"A Photo Map\", AndroFotoFinder\n\nEnhanced, privacy aware Android **[Gallery App](https://github.com/k3b/APhotoManager/wiki/Gallery-View)** to manage local photos: \n\n* Free, opensource, no adds, no user tracking, available on [f-droid](https://f-droid.org/)\n* [Translations](https://crowdin.com/project/AndroFotoFinder): \u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/ar-home\"\u003ear\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/de-home\"\u003ede\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/home\"   \u003een\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/it-home\"\u003eit\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/fr-home\"\u003efr\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/ja-home\"\u003eja\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/nl-Home\"\u003enl\u003c/a\u003e,\u0026nbsp;pl,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/pt-home\"\u003ept\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/ro-home\"\u003ero\u003c/a\u003e,\u0026nbsp;ru\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/tr-home\"\u003etr\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/uk-home\"\u003euk\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/zh-CN-home\"\u003ezh-CN\u003c/a\u003e,\u0026nbsp;\u003ca href=\"https://github.com/k3b/APhotoManager/wiki/zh-TW-home\"\u003ezh-TW\u003c/a\u003e\n\t* [![Crowdin](https://d322cqt584bo4o.cloudfront.net/androFotoFinder/localized.svg)](https://crowdin.com/project/androFotoFinder)\u003ca href=\"https://github.com/k3b/APhotoManager/issues/21\"\u003eHelp us to translate into other languages.\u003c/a\u003e\n\t\n## Highlights:\n\n* [geotagging with map](https://github.com/k3b/APhotoManager/wiki/example-geosearch), \n* [Virtual Albums](https://github.com/k3b/APhotoManager/wiki/Bookmarks) filesystem-folder indepenant,\n* Filemanagement: copy, move, rename, delete, send, [Incremental Photo Backup](https://github.com/k3b/APhotoManager/wiki/Backup-to-zip), ... .\n* [Edit exif metadata](https://github.com/k3b/AndroFotoFinder/wiki/Exif-Edit): date, title, description, [tags(keywords)](https://github.com/k3b/APhotoManager/wiki/Tags), geo, rating, ....\n* management:  on-move automatically [rename photo-files](https://github.com/k3b/AndroFotoFinder/wiki/AutoProcessing) and/or [add photo properties(exif)](https://github.com/k3b/AndroFotoFinder/wiki/AutoProcessing),\n* Can handle big image collections (20000+ images in 1000+ folders).\n* Small memory footprint (1.5 MB), Works on old low-memory android 4.0 devices\n* available in [many languages](https://github.com/k3b/APhotoManager/issues/21)\n* Extended photo media scanner for Exif, IPTC, XMP\n\n## Privacy:\n\n* can [hide photos](https://github.com/k3b/APhotoManager/wiki/Exif-Edit#Visibility) from other gallery-apps/image-pickers.\n* [Vault mode](https://github.com/k3b/APhotoManager/wiki/AppPinning): If enabled unwanted photos cannot be seen.\n* photos are kept on local device. No upload to third party.\n* no adds, no usertracking, free open source, available on f-droid\n\n## Required Android Permissions:\n\n* INTERNET: to download map data from Open Streetmap Server\n* ACCESS_NETWORK_STATE and ACCESS_WIFI_STATE: to find out if wifi/internet is online to start downloaded geodata\n* WRITE_EXTERNAL_STORAGE to cache downloaded map data in local file system and to do file operations with the photos\n* READ_LOGS to read and save potential crash-logs to a textfile.\n\n---\u003cbr/\u003e\n[\u003cimg src=\"https://github.com/k3b/APhotoManager/wiki/uptodown.png\" alt=\"available on upToDown store\" height=\"82\" width=\"324\"\u003e](https://a-photo-manager.en.uptodown.com/android) [\u003cimg src=\"https://github.com/k3b/APhotoManager/wiki/fdroid.png\" alt=\"available on F-Droid app store\" height=\"82\" width=\"324\"\u003e](https://f-droid.org/app/de.k3b.android.androFotoFinder)\u003cbr/\u003e\n[Downloads](https://github.com/k3b/APhotoManager/wiki/Download)\u003cbr/\u003e\n**[DISCLAIMER Be cautious if you download \"A Photo Manager\" where the apk size is bigger than 1.5 Megabytes](https://github.com/k3b/APhotoManager/wiki/Download)**:\u003cbr/\u003e\n---\u003cbr/\u003e\n\n## Features\n\n[... features more detailed](https://github.com/k3b/APhotoManager/wiki/features)\n\n**Help wanted for further [Translations](https://crowdin.com/project/AndroFotoFinder)**\n\n## Current Project Status\n\n* Current release\n  * \u003cimg src=\"https://img.shields.io/github/release/k3b/APhotoManager.svg?maxAge=3600\" /\u003e\n  * [\u003cimg src=\"https://github.com/k3b/APhotoManager/wiki/uptodown.png\" alt=\"available on upToDown store\" height=\"82\" width=\"324\"\u003e](https://a-photo-manager.en.uptodown.com/android) [\u003cimg src=\"https://github.com/k3b/APhotoManager/wiki/fdroid.png\" alt=\"available on F-Droid app store\" height=\"82\" width=\"324\"\u003e](https://f-droid.org/app/de.k3b.android.androFotoFinder) \n  * [\u003cimg src=\"https://img.shields.io/github/license/k3b/APhotoManager.svg\"\u003e\u003c/img\u003e](https://github.com/k3b/APhotoManager/blob/master/LICENSE) or later.\n  * Code Quality [![Codacy Badge](https://api.codacy.com/project/badge/Grade/df65509fc428454791603de5f3bb7707)](https://www.codacy.com/app/klaus3b-github/APhotoManager?utm_source=github.com\u0026amp;utm_medium=referral\u0026amp;utm_content=k3b/APhotoManager\u0026amp;utm_campaign=Badge_Grade)\n  * Source code [branch FDroid \u003cimg src=\"https://travis-ci.org/k3b/APhotoManager.svg?branch=FDroid\" alt=\"link to buldserver\"  /\u003e](https://travis-ci.org/k3b/APhotoManager)\n  * Recent changes see [History](https://github.com/k3b/APhotoManager/wiki/History)  \n* Current development version\n  * Source code [branch master \u003cimg src=\"https://travis-ci.org/k3b/APhotoManager.svg?branch=master\" alt=\"link to branches on buldserver\" /\u003e](https://travis-ci.org/k3b/APhotoManager/branches)\n  * Translations [![Crowdin](https://d322cqt584bo4o.cloudfront.net/androFotoFinder/localized.svg)](https://crowdin.com/project/androFotoFinder)\u003ca href=\"https://github.com/k3b/APhotoManager/issues/21\"\u003eHelp us to translate into other languages.\u003c/a\u003e\n\n## Table of Contents\n\n* [Overview](https://github.com/k3b/APhotoManager/wiki/features)\n* [Download](https://github.com/k3b/APhotoManager/wiki/Download)\n* [Walk Through: Gallery, Filter, Map, Folder picker](https://github.com/k3b/APhotoManager/wiki/example-geosearch)\n* [Gallery-View](https://github.com/k3b/APhotoManager/wiki/Gallery-View)\n* [Geographic-Map](https://github.com/k3b/APhotoManager/wiki/geographic-map)\n* [Image-View](https://github.com/k3b/APhotoManager/wiki/Image-View)\n* [Edit Exif infos](Exif-Edit) of photo(s)\n* [Filter-View](https://github.com/k3b/APhotoManager/wiki/Filter-View)\n* [tags (keywords)](https://github.com/k3b/APhotoManager/wiki/Tags)\n* [Virtual Albums](https://github.com/k3b/APhotoManager/wiki/Bookmarks)\n* [Incremental Photo Backup](https://github.com/k3b/APhotoManager/wiki/Backup-to-zip)\n* [AutoProcessing](https://github.com/k3b/AndroFotoFinder/wiki/AutoProcessing)\n* [Folder-Picker](https://github.com/k3b/APhotoManager/wiki/Folder-Picker)\n* [Settings](https://github.com/k3b/APhotoManager/wiki/settings)\n* [Intent API](https://github.com/k3b/APhotoManager/wiki/intentapi)\n\n\n![](https://raw.githubusercontent.com/k3b/APhotoManager/master/wiki/png/SelectArea.png)\n\n![](https://raw.githubusercontent.com/k3b/APhotoManager/master/wiki/png/Gallery.png)\n\n![](https://raw.githubusercontent.com/k3b/APhotoManager/master/wiki/png/FolderPicker.png)\n\n\n## Contributing and Bugreports\n\nFeedback, translation and contributions are welcomed. \n\n* [Discuss pro and cons, features, featurerequests and to provide news and support about the app on reddit.](https://www.reddit.com/r/APhotoManager/)\n* [Issue tracker](https://github.com/k3b/APhotoManager/issues)\n* You can help to translate this app via https://crowdin.com/project/AndroFotoFinder\n-----\n\n## Donations: \n\nIf you like this app please consider to donating to https://wiki.openstreetmap.org/wiki/Donations .\n\nSince android-developping is a hobby (and an education tool) i donot want any \nmoney for my apps so donation should go to projects i benefit from.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fk3b%2FAPhotoManager","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fk3b%2FAPhotoManager","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fk3b%2FAPhotoManager/lists"}